Category: Dessert, SnackCuisine: AmericanCalories: 68 per serving1. Carefully pour the boiling water into a heat safe bowl. Then dissolve the sugar free jello in the bowling water, stirring to enable dissolve process
2. Stir in the ice water until ice to fully melted.
3. Next, stir in the whipped topping and then switch to a whisk to whip this. Once blended, you can refrigerate for 20-30 minutes or until thickened.
4. Remove the thickened pie filling and transfer it to the pie crust or serving dish if you are going crust free. Top with the lime zest. Refrigerate until firm
